A boy playing on the roof of a 10m high building throws a ball with a speed of 10 m/s at an angle of 30⁰ with the horizontal. How far from the throwing point will the ball be at the height of 10 m from the ground(g=10 ms⁻²)?

Options

(a) 8.66 m
(b) 5.20 m
(c) 4.33 m
(d) 2.60 m

Correct Answer:

8.66 m
